What is Bay Crush?

With fresh celery and herbal notes, Old Bay Vodka and triple sec combine to create the Bay Crush, which would pair well with crab dishes and other seafood entrees.

Ingredients for Bay Crush

My Bar
1½ oz cointreau liqueur (buy)
2 oz lemon juice (freshly squeezed) (buy)
3 oz lemon lime soda (e.g. 7-up, Sprite) (buy)
1½ oz old bay vodka

Step‑by‑Step Instructions

  1. In a shaker filled with ice add Old Bay vodka, triple sec, and lemon juice and shake until chilled.
  2. Strain into a cocktail glass filled with ice and top off with Sprite. Garnish with lemon wheel(optional)
